Determination of critical and optimum conditions for biomethanization of OFMSW in a semi-continuous stirred tank reactor
چکیده انگلیسی

In this paper, the critical and the optimum conditions for thermophilic-dry anaerobic digestion have been determined employing two types of Organic Fraction of Municipal Solid Waste (OFMSW): synthetic (average particle size of 1 mm) and industrial (average particle size of 30 mm). On the basis of the methane production rate and the removal percentage of organic matter achieved, four SRT were tested to determine the values of the critical and optimum parameters for each waste. The results point to a SRT of 15 days as the optimum SRT for both types of waste. In the case of the synthetic OFMSW, this SRT is characterized by an organic loading rate of 11.8 × 103 mg VS/L d. To the industrial OFMSW, the organic loading rate corresponding to this SRT is 2.93 × 103 mg VS/L d.On the other hand, the SRT from which takes placed a destabilization of the process depends on the type of waste. For the synthetic OFMSW, this SRT was 8 days (22.1 × 103 mg VS/L d), whereas for the industrial OFMSW it was 10 days (4.39 × 103 mg VS/L d).
